Construction and Application of Online Monitoring System Based on FBG Roof Separation Indicator

Abstract: Aiming at the existing problems of low efficiency,lagging monitoring results,poor reliability and accuracy in present roadway roof separation monitor,a new highprecision FBG separation indicator was designed through theoretical analysis,laboratory test and field test according to the fiber grating sensing principle.On this basis,a realtime online roof separation monitoring system was proposed.The calibration and performance test results of roof separator indicator suggested that it has good linearity sensitivity and high sensitivity.The linear fitting coefficient is 0.998 3 respectively.The sensitivity coefficient is 1.6 pm/mm.The minimum separation variation of about 0.63 mm can be monitored.The monitoring system was successfully applied to roof separation monitoring of the14301 # track roadway in Shaqu Coalmine.The monitoring results showed that the online roof separation monitoring system based on the highprecision FBG separation indicator has the advantages of high precision,good stability and longdistance signal transmission,which can achieve realtime dynamic monitoring and provides an effective method for longterm online monitoring of roadway roof separation.

Key words: fiber grating sensing,FBG roof separation indicator,roadway roof separation,online monitoring system
